Abstract

The disclosed embodiments include systems and methods to perform in-situ analysis of reservoir fluids. In some embodiments, the system includes a first vial containing a first insulating cylinder having a first internal cavity for storing electrolytes, a capillary tube, and a first sealable end having a first seal that prevents the electrolytes that are stored in the first internal cavity from flowing through the first sealable end while the first seal remains intact. The system also includes a second vial containing a second insulating cylinder having a second internal cavity for receiving the electrolytes that are stored in the first insulating cylinder, and a second sealable end having a second seal. The system further includes a tube positioned between the first vial and the second vial, where the tube provides at least one fluid flow path between the first vial and the second vial.
